What type of penicillin is used for dogs?

Penicillins also are used topically in the eye and ear as well as on the skin; intramammary administration is common for treatment or prevention of bovine mastitis. Amoxicillin with or without clavulanic acid is among the first-choice antimicrobials for treatment of canine or feline urinary tract infections.

Can I give fish penicillin to my dog?

Technically, they should fall under the purview of the Food and Drug Administration, which oversees both human and animal drugs. Those animals including companion animals (dogs, cats, horses) and food animals (cattle, pigs, chickens). Yet no ornamental fish antibiotics are approved by the FDA.Aug 16, 2017

Is fish amoxicillin the same as dog amoxicillin?

CLAIM: Taking fish amoxicillin used in aquariums is the same as using amoxicillin prescribed by a doctor, just less expensive and does not require a prescription. AP'S ASSESSMENT: False.Feb 20, 2020
